Optimal Dumpster Placement
Choosing the right location ensures secure and convenient access. Ensure the placement area is even, clear, and sturdy. Steer clear of soft or wet ground which may destabilize the dumpster. Load the Dumpster Strategically
How you load your dumpster affects both space and safety. Begin with heavy objects on the bottom and stack lighter items above. Deconstruct large materials to maximize container space safely. Level all debris with the container’s edge for safety. Our team shares loading strategies to maximize your rental’s effectiveness.
Prioritize Safety When Using a Dumpster
Safety should always be a priority when handling waste. Wear protective gear like gloves and strong shoes. Avoid lifting heavy or awkward objects alone, and use tools like wheelbarrows or dollies when necessary. Clear the area of kids, pets, and others to maintain safety.
